ACCESS CONTROL Belvoir’s 24-hour gate to main post is Tulley Gate. The gate is at the intersection of U.S. Route 1 and Pohick Road. Commercial vehicles must enter post through Tulley Gate. Visitors without Department of Defense identification cards must also enter through Tulley Gate. The visitor center is open from 6 a.m. to 6 p.m., Monday through Friday. All after hour visitors will be processed at Tulley Gate in the commercial/visitor lanes. Valid, U.S. government-issued ID card holders may enter through any gate. Gate hours are subject to change at any time. Hours may be changed for holidays, special events or other requirements. The gates are listed below. To view the current operating hours, visit home.army.mil/belvoir and search “Installation Access/ Gates.” J.J. KINGMAN GATE TULLEY GATE PENCE GATE FARRAR GATE (DAVISON ARMY AIRFIELD) LIEBER GATE TELEGRAPH GATE WALKER GATE SPEED LIMITS AND CELL PHONE USE In residential villages, speed limits are 15 mph. Limits vary in

other areas on post, but all are strictly enforced by the Fort Belvoir Police Department. Violators may be cited and could receive a U.S. Magistrate ticket. Additionally, Department of Defense policy prohibits using cell phones while driving, unless used with a hands-free device. Violators may receive a Department of Defense Form 1408, Armed Forces Traffic Ticket, which will be forwarded to your organization. ARRIVING AT FORT BELVOIR Uniformed military personnel reporting to Fort Belvoir on orders will sign in at their unit of assignment prior to inprocessing at the Welcome Center, located at Bldg. 1189, at 9625 Middleton Road. Soldiers must have a copy of DA Form 31 (Leave), assignment orders and/or amendments. Information pertaining to your Record of Emergency Data (DD Form 93) and Service member’s Group Life Insurance (SGLI) will be updated at this time. House hunters should report on the day permissive temporary duty begins. Service members must be in Duty Uniform. Those arriving at Dulles or Ronald Reagan Airport, it is your responsibility to coordinate and complete your travel to Fort Belvoir. Ensure that you save all your receipts so that you can make an appropriate travel claim when you in-process the installation. To learn more about In-Processing, visit the “For Newcomers” page on the Fort Belvoir website at home.army.mil/ belvoir.

LODGING Belvoir’s lodging operations are managed by IHG Army Hotels, bringing branded hotels to U.S. Army installations. Along with comfortable rooms, IHG facilities offer high-speed internet access, a business center, on-site fitness facilities and guest self-serve laundry at its Knadle Hall location. To book your stay, visit www. ihgarmyhotels.com or call 877-711-TEAM (8326). If your stay at Fort Belvoir is for institutional training, call 703-704-8600 first to avoid double booking. The IHG’s Staybridge Suites is in Bldg. 1208, across from Belvoir Hospital, near the Fisher House and Community Center, 703-844-0303. FINANCE The primary route for submitting pay actions is through your unit PAC/S-1/HR POC; however, Army Military Pay Office (AMPO) – Fort Belvoir is available for finance services weekdays from 7:30 a.m. to 3 p.m., except Wednesdays when the office is open from 7:30 a.m. to 11:00 a.m. Learn more on the Fort Belvoir website at home.army.mil/belvoir, search “Army Military Pay Office (AMPO) - Fort Belvoir.” IDENTIFICATION CARDS The Directorate of Human Resources Military Personnel Division manages Fort Belvoir’s ID Card issuing facility. The office is at 9625 Middleton Rd., Bldg. 1189. ID cards are issued from 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. Patrons must arrive by 3:45 p.m. to be served the same day. Appointments are recommended and can be made online at https://rapids-appointments.dmdc.osd.mil.

8

A signed Application for Uniformed Services Identification Care/DEERS Enrollment form (DD Form 1172-2) is required for issuing cards. Family members may get cards without the sponsor

if the form is signed by the sponsor in the presence of a verifying official, or if it is signed by the sponsor and notarized. To make any additions or changes in the Defense Enrollment and Eligibility Reporting System, original documents or certified true copies must be presented. Examples of documentation include marriage certificates, birth certificates and Social Security cards. Depending on the update requested, divorce, adoption and custody decrees may be required. For more information about ID cards, visit the office website at home.armymil/belvoir and search “DEERS/ID Cards.” MOTORCYCLE SAFETY REQUIREMENTS Fort Belvoir Regulation 190-5, Directorate of Emergency Services Uniform Traffic Regulation, requires military and civilian riders to wear proper eye protection, full-fingered gloves, long trousers and a long-sleeved shirt or jacket. Military riders must complete the Basic Rider’s Course before they are allowed to ride, whether on or off post. Within 12 months of completion of the basic course, military riders must also complete the Experienced Rider Course or the Sport Bike Riders Course. To arrange training, visit the Installation Safety Office website at home.army.mil/belvoir and search “Safety Office”, or call 703-704-0649. FIREARMS AND BICYCLE REGISTRATION The Staff Sergeant John D. Linde Visitors Processing Operation Center at Tulley Gate conducts firearm and bicycle registrations. The center operates from 6 a.m. to 6 p.m. weekdays. For additional information call 703-806-4891. Military members and their families who are assigned, attached or living at Fort Belvoir billeting or quarters must register all privately owned firearms within 72 hours of being brought on to the installation. FAMILY HOUSING (ON POST) Fort Belvoir Residential Communities provides on-post homes to military families throughout the National Capital Region. The program’s goal is to improve the quality of life for military families by offering safe, affordable and attractive residential communities known as The Villages at Belvoir. Comprised of new, historic, and traditional housing in 15 distinct Villages, homes are offered with 2- to 5-bedroom floor plans. All homes offer electric washer/dryer connections, dishwashers, refrigerators and high-speed internet connection. New homes are ENERGY STAR-certified and boast at least three bedrooms and two full baths. They also include ninefoot ceilings on the first floor, 42” cabinets, ceiling fans and Corian countertops. All homes also feature fiber optic cable to the home. For more information, contact the Family Housing Welcome Center at 703-619-3877 or 888-740-9851. Visit the Villages at Belvoir website at http://www.villagesatbelvoir.com.

10

UNACCOMPANIED HOUSING (ON POST) Fort Belvoir’s barracks in-processing office is located at 9801 Gunston Road, Building 2105. Service members are required to

register for the app - ArMa (Army Maintenance) Program at www. armymaintenance.com/arma. This system will allow you to submit work orders via the ArMa app. For more information, please contact UPH Housing at 703-806-0489. HOUSING SERVICES OFFICE (OFF POST) The Housing Services Office is a branch of The Fort Belvoir Residential Communities Liaison Office. The office’s overall goal is to implement and maintain a high-quality, worldwide resource for relocation services that is innovative, comprehensive and the first choice of information and support when Soldiers and families relocate. These services include, but are not limited to, home-buying and -selling support; rental property listings; temporary housing listings; off-post, quality housing inspections; in and out-processing; permissive temporary duty (PTDY) stamp; lease review; landlord and tenant mediation; and advocacy. Contact the office at 703-8053018/3019. The Housing Services Office is available on the web at home.army.mil/belvoir, search “Fort Belvoir Housing Services Office.”

ARMY COMMUNITY SERVICE ARMY COMMUNITY SERVICE (ACS) is dedicated to improving the quality of life of military Families through education, information and support services. ACS offers many programs and services that are designed to equip Service members, Family Members, Retirees, and Department of Defense (DoD) Civilians, with the skills, knowledge and support they need to face the challenges of military life. EMPLOYMENT READINESS PROGRAM (ERP) assists Service members, Family Members, Retirees, and Department of Defense Civilians in acquiring skills, networks and resources that will allow them to join the work force and develop a career plan. Workshops are held regularly on such topics as local area job search, career development, federal employment application, resume preparation and a variety of other job-related subjects.

EXCEPTIONAL FAMILY MEMBER PROGRAM (EFMP) offers support, education, information, systems navigation, 12 referrals, and more to Active Duty Soldiers

with a special needs spouse or child. The EFMP Respite Care program provides temporary rest periods for Family members responsible for the regular care of persons with disabilities. FAMILY ADVOCACY PROGRAM (FAP) provides educational programs and support services aimed at strengthening Family relationships and alleviating the stress of everyday Family life. Educational programs are offered both as a part of regular military unit training and for the community through workshops and seminars. Call 571231-7001. Our 24 hr. Domestic Violence hotline number is 703-229-2374.

combination of the two. Loans are repaid by an allotment. MILITARY AND FAMILY LIFE COUNSELOR (MFLC) provides short term, situational, problem-solving counseling services to Active Duty Service members and their Family Members. MFLCs assist with the impact of deployments, family reunions following deployments, and the stresses of military life.

FINANCIAL READINESS PROGRAM (FRP) provides counseling, consumer education classes, debt liquidation, emergency food assistance, and more, to Service members, Family Members, Retirees, and Department of Defense Civilians.

NEW PARENT SUPPORT PROGRAM (NPSP) offers supportive and caring services to military Families with children form prenatal to three years of age. NPSP provides opportunities to learn to cope with stress, isolation, post-deployment, reunions and the everyday demands of parenthood. The NPSP professional social workers and nurses offer a variety of programs such as home visits, parenting classes, playgroup, infant massage, and stroller walking group.

ARMY EMERGENCY RELIEF (AER) is a private, non-profit organization established to assist Soldiers and Retirees in emergency financial situations due to no fault of their own. Financial assistance is given in the form of an interest-free loan, grant, or

RELOCATION ASSISTANCE PROGRAM (RAP) provides PCS information, relocation classes, temporary use of household goods through the Lending Closet, Welcome Packets and presents the monthly Newcomers Orientation.

AQUATICS Through a variety of classes, programs and services, Fort Belvoir Aquatics focuses on water fitness, health and safety, and leisure. There are three pools available to Family and MWR patrons on Fort Belvoir, each at distinct operations and locations. Year round, the BENYAURD INDOOR POOL offers a six (6) lane, 25-yard lap pool along with water exercise equipment. They also offer water aerobics, scuba classes, swimming lessons and lifeguard training. THE CONNELLY POOL COMPLEX (adjacent to the Officers’ Club), is a seasonal pool open Memorial Day to Labor Day. Daily and seasonal Pool passes are available to purchase at the Officers’ Club Membership desk. THE NORTH POST OUTDOOR POOL is also a seasonal open Memorial Day to Labor Day, but passes for this facility can be purchased directly at the Pool entrance.

MARINA AND RV STORAGE LOT Located near Walker Gate at Dogue Creek with the beautiful Potomac River in the background, Fort Belvoir’s Marina offers a unique boating experience for boat owners. The Marina offers space for storing and launching privately owned boats. Wet slips with water and electric are available along with standard dry trailered storage. For a small fee, there is a boat lift and launch ramp available (launch fee included with monthly storage). This office also manages the RV Storage Lot. RV storage is gated with 24/7 gate key access.

DLA provides effective and efficient global solutions to Warfighters and our other valued customers. Our vision is clear: Deliver the right solution on time, every time. As America’s 2

combat logistics support agency, DLA provides the Army, Marine Corps, Navy, Air Force, other federal agencies and partnernation armed forces with a full spectrum of logistics, acquisition and technical services. DLA sources and provides nearly all of the consumable items America’s military forces need to operate – from food, fuel and energy to uniforms, medical supplies and construction material. DLA generated more than $38 billion in sales and revenue last year. The agency employs nearly 25,000 civilians and military, in 48 states and 28 countries. DLA operates 24 distribution depots supporting more than 2,430 weapons systems; and manages nine supply chains with nearly 5.3 million line items. In 2014, DLA received nearly $40 billion in excess and surplus property that was reutilized, transferred, disposed of or donated. Additionally, DLA administers the storage and disposal of strategic and critical materials to support national defense. Headquartered at Fort Belvoir, DLA is a global enterprise – wherever the United States has a significant military presence, DLA is there to support.

DEFENSE THREAT REDUCTION AGENCY/ U.S. STRATEGIC COMMAND CENTER FOR COMBATING WEAPONS OF MASS DESTRUCTION

DTRA is the Department of Defense’s official combat support agency for countering weapons of mass destruction, addressing the entire spectrum of chemical, biological, radiological, nuclear and high-yield explosive threats. DTRA’s programs include basic science research and development, operational support to U.S. warfighters on the frontline, and an in-house WMD think tank that aims to anticipate and mitigate future threats long before they have a chance to harm the United States and our allies. SCC-WMD, the U.S. Strategic Command Center for Combating Weapons of Mass Destruction,

synchronizes Combating Weapons of Mass Destruction efforts across our military’s geographic commands and leverages the people, programs and interagency relationships of DTRA at a strategic level. We work with the military services, other elements of the U.S. government, and countries across the planet on counter proliferation, nonproliferation and WMD reduction issues, with one goal in mind: Making the World Safer.
